Product Description

These are tasty, crunchy snacks made with chia seeds and a hint of sea salt. They're perfect for munching on their own or dipping in your favorite spread. Great for anyone who enjoys a healthy snack!

Product Benefits

Rich In Fiber. Gluten-Free Option. Low In Calories. Satisfying Crunch.

other Ingredients: Brown Rice Flour, Potato Starch, Extra Virgin Olive Oil, Chia Seeds, Sunflower Seeds, Sea Salt, Garlic, White Pepper.


Suggestions

Light, crunchy thins great on their own or paired with dips, cheeses, or spreads. Often chosen for added fiber and omega 3 from chia seeds.
